Top 10 Best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science Schools
Our 2023 rankings named Andrews University the best school in Michigan for clinical/medical laboratory science students. Located in the town of Berrien Springs, Andrews is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.
The excellent programs at Ferris State University hel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the best clinical/medical laboratory science schools in Michigan. Ferris is a large public school located in the town of Big Rapids.

A rank of #3 on this year’s list means Delta College is a great place for clinical/medical laboratory science students. Delta College is a medium-sized public school located in the rural area of University Center.

A rank of #4 on this year’s list means Baker College is a great place for clinical/medical laboratory science students. Baker College is a small private not-for-profit school located in the town of Owosso.

The excellent programs at Michigan State University helped the school earn the #5 place on this year’s ranking of the best clinical/medical laboratory science schools in Michigan. Michigan State is a fairly large public school located in the city of East Lansing.
Grand Valley State University ranked #6 on this year’s Best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science Trade Schools in Michigan list. Located in the suburb of Allendale, GVSU is a public college with a very large student population.
Saginaw Valley State University landed the #7 spot in the 2023 rankings for the best clinical/medical laboratory science programs. Located in the suburb of University Center, Saginaw Valley State University is a public school with a moderately-sized student population.
Northern Michigan University did quite well in this year’s ranking of the best schools for clinical/medical laboratory science students. It came in at #8 on the list. Located in the town of Marquette, Northern Michigan University is a public college with a medium-sized student population.

Wayne State University landed the #9 spot in the 2023 rankings for the best clinical/medical laboratory science programs. Wayne State is a fairly large public school located in the city of Detroit.

Eastern Michigan University came in at #10 in this year’s edition of the Best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science Trade Schools in Michigan ranking. Eastern Michigan is a fairly large public school located in the large suburb of Ypsilanti.
